<br /> <br /> <br /> <br />REGULAR SEtH-MONTHLY MEETING OF THE <br />CITY OOUNCIL OF ELK RIVER <br />HELD IN THE COUNCIL CHAMBERS OF THE CITY OFFICE BLDG. <br /> <br />May 16, 1977 at 7:30 PM. <br /> <br />Members present Mayor Lundberg, Councilmembers Konop, Toth, Syring and otto. <br /> <br />The minutes of the Special Meeting held May 9, 1977 were reviewed the last paragraph <br />should read Sr. High School a~~rQokn~b~~g~~S~~~~te~S there were no other corrections <br />or additions noted the minutes-Me-.LSpecial I<1eet:~ng.held May 6, 1977 were reviewed <br />as there were no additions or corrections the minutes were approved as printed. The <br />regular minutes of the meeting held May 2, 1977 were reviewed as there were no additions <br />or corrections the minutes were approved as printed. <br /> <br />Lyle Swanson City Engineer presented the proposed preliminary engineering report for <br />the 1977 street improvements for Councils review.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Toth and seconded by Councilmember Syring accepting the Preliminary <br />Engineering Report for the 1977 Street Improvements dated May 1977 and prepared by <br />McCombs-Knutson Associates, Inc. and calling for a public hearing on the proposed 1977 <br />Street Improvements for June 6, 1977 at 8:00 PM. and authorizing the City Clerk to <br />advertise in the Sherburne County Star News. Motion unanimously carried by a vote of <br />5-0.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Otto and' seconded by Councilmember Konop adopting the resolution <br />"Offer and Acceptance of State of Minnesota Grant for Disposal Systems". Motion <br />un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. A copy of the resolution is attached. <br /> <br />Eugene N. Kreuser and Warren S. Carlson met with the Council and presented a petition <br />for the services of water and sewer for the North side of Fifth Street East and that <br />part of the S~ t of the ME t of Section 34, Township 33, Range 26 fronting on Fifth Street <br />East, east of US Highway 169, Elk River, Minnesota.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Syring and seconded by Councilmember otto authorizing City <br />Engineer Lyle Swanson to draft a letter to Cepco, Inc. Attn: Warren Carlson; President <br />stating that water and sewer are available for the above described property . Motion <br />un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. <br /> <br />The Council also recommended that Mr. Kreuser submit an overall plot plan of all <br />properties to include Elk Hills Addition for the Elk River Planning Commission. <br /> <br />Mayor Lundberg declared the public hearing to consider adoption of shore land and scenic <br />rivers ordinance and re-defining the Cit~es present flood plain ordinance open at 8:20 PM. <br /> <br />Paul Swenson and Mike Robertson of the Dept. of Natural Resourse were in attendance no <br />local residents were in attendance. <br /> <br />Mr. Robertson reviewed the flood plain ordinance and Mr~ Swenson reviewed the shoreland <br />and scenic riyers ordinance for the Council. <br /> <br />Bec'ause of the time factors involved in meeting the June 1, 1977 deadline set forth <br />by the~ate and Federal legislative mandate requirements the City Council passed the <br />follow~ng motion. Moved by Councilmember Syring and seconded by Councilmember Toth <br />adopting the interim ordinances addendum I "Management of the Mississippi Wild, Scenic, <br />and Recreational Rivers System and the Shoreland Areas of the City of Elk River" and <br />addendum II "Flood Plain Management" to the City present Zoning and Building Code Ordinance <br />and authorize the City Clerk to publish the proper notice in the SherbUrne County Star <br />News. Motion un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. <br /> <br />Neil Larson met with the CoUncil regarding his preliminary plot plan of Ridgewood East <br />2nd Addition. <br />
